Apidog

Plataforma de desarrollo de API colaborativa todo en uno

Diseño de API

Documentación de API

Depuración de API

Simulación de API

Prueba automatizada de API

Las 10 mejores alternativas a Cursor AI (Mejores que Github Copilot, Código Abierto)

Explora las 10 mejores alternativas a Cursor AI, incluyendo opciones de código abierto, para encontrar las mejores herramientas para tu codificación y edición con IA. Compara funciones, usabilidad e integraciones.

Daniel Costa

Daniel Costa

Updated on April 15, 2025

¿Eres fan del editor Cursor Code pero sientes curiosidad por otras herramientas que podrían adaptarse mejor a tus necesidades? Tanto si eres un desarrollador experimentado como si estás empezando a incursionar en el mundo de los editores de código impulsados por IA, siempre es bueno explorar alternativas. Esta entrada de blog te guiará a través de las 9 mejores alternativas a Cursor AI, incluyendo algunas excelentes opciones de código abierto. Cada una aporta algo único, así que seguro que encuentras una que encaje con tu flujo de trabajo.

1. TabNine — El prodigio de autocompletado impulsado por IA

TabNine es una de las herramientas de autocompletado de código impulsadas por IA más populares que existen. Se integra perfectamente con muchos editores de código, incluyendo VSCode, Atom, Sublime Text y más. TabNine utiliza modelos de aprendizaje automático entrenados en una amplia variedad de bases de código, lo que significa que puede predecir y sugerir líneas o bloques de código enteros con una precisión impresionante.

¿Por qué considerar TabNine?

  • Soporte de idiomas: Tanto si estás programando en Python, JavaScript, C++ o incluso Rust, TabNine te tiene cubierto.
  • Facilidad de integración: La capacidad de TabNine para integrarse con casi cualquier editor de código lo convierte en una opción versátil.
  • Versiones gratuitas y de pago: TabNine ofrece una versión gratuita con funciones básicas y una versión de pago con capacidades de IA más avanzadas.

Dónde se queda corto: La versión gratuita de TabNine, aunque potente, no ofrece el conjunto completo de funciones disponibles en la versión de pago, lo que podría ser una limitación para algunos usuarios.

2. Kite — El asistente de IA con un fuerte enfoque en Python

Kite es otro asistente de codificación impulsado por IA que es especialmente popular entre los desarrolladores de Python. Ofrece finalizaciones de código inteligentes, documentación mientras codificas e incluso fragmentos de código.

¿Por qué considerar Kite?

  • Dominio de Python: Si Python es tu principal lenguaje de programación, las optimizaciones de Kite para Python lo convierten en un fuerte competidor.
  • Documentación en tiempo real: Kite proporciona documentación en tiempo real mientras escribes, lo que puede ser increíblemente útil cuando intentas entender código desconocido.
  • Soporte multilingüe: Aunque Kite destaca con Python, también soporta JavaScript, Java, C++ y otros lenguajes.

Dónde se queda corto: Kite ha sido criticado por su soporte limitado de lenguajes en comparación con TabNine, lo que lo hace menos versátil para los desarrolladores que trabajan con múltiples lenguajes.

3. GitHub Copilot — El programador de pares de IA del futuro

GitHub Copilot ha causado sensación en la comunidad de desarrolladores por su capacidad para generar funciones enteras, escribir código repetitivo e incluso ayudar con la depuración. Construido sobre el modelo Codex de OpenAI, entiende las indicaciones en lenguaje natural, lo que lo convierte en una herramienta poderosa tanto para principiantes como para desarrolladores experimentados.

¿Por qué considerar GitHub Copilot?

  • Comprensión del lenguaje natural: Puedes describir el código que quieres en inglés sencillo, y Copilot lo generará por ti.
  • Amplio soporte de idiomas: Desde Python hasta Go, Copilot soporta una amplia gama de lenguajes de programación.
  • Aprendizaje continuo: Copilot aprende de los repositorios de código público y evoluciona, asegurándose de que se mantiene al día con las últimas prácticas de codificación.

Dónde se queda corto: La dependencia de Copilot del código público a veces puede generar problemas de licencia. Además, requiere una suscripción a GitHub después del período de prueba.

4. Codeium — El retador de código abierto

Si estás buscando una alternativa potente, gratuita y de código abierto, Codeium podría ser justo lo que necesitas. Codeium proporciona sugerencias de código impulsadas por IA, autocompletados e incluso soporta múltiples lenguajes.

¿Por qué considerar Codeium?

  • Código abierto: La naturaleza de código abierto de Codeium significa que puedes personalizarlo para que se ajuste a tus necesidades.
  • Impulsado por la comunidad: Con una fuerte comunidad detrás, Codeium se mejora y actualiza constantemente.
  • Soporte multilingüe: Soporta varios lenguajes, lo que lo convierte en una herramienta versátil para los desarrolladores.

Dónde se queda corto: Al ser de código abierto, Codeium podría no tener la experiencia de usuario pulida que ofrecen algunas herramientas propietarias.

5. OpenAI Codex — El cerebro detrás de GitHub Copilot

Aunque GitHub Copilot está construido sobre Codex de OpenAI, el propio Codex puede utilizarse de forma independiente para una codificación más avanzada impulsada por IA. Codex entiende y genera código en múltiples lenguajes de programación, proporcionando sugerencias basadas en entradas de lenguaje natural.

¿Por qué considerar OpenAI Codex?

  • Flexibilidad: Puedes utilizar Codex para construir herramientas de codificación de IA personalizadas adaptadas a tus necesidades específicas.
  • Funciones avanzadas: Codex ofrece capacidades más avanzadas en comparación con herramientas preconstruidas como GitHub Copilot.
  • Versatilidad de idiomas: Soporta docenas de lenguajes de programación, lo que lo convierte en una herramienta universal para los desarrolladores.

Dónde se queda corto: Codex puede ser complejo de configurar y utilizar, lo que lo hace menos accesible para los principiantes.

6. Intellicode — Asistencia de código impulsada por IA de Microsoft

Intellicode de Microsoft es un potente asistente de código de IA integrado en Visual Studio y Visual Studio Code. Proporciona recomendaciones contextuales, haciendo que la codificación sea más rápida y menos propensa a errores.

¿Por qué considerar Intellicode?

  • Integración con Visual Studio: La profunda integración de Intellicode con Visual Studio y VSCode lo convierte en una elección natural para los desarrolladores que ya utilizan estos IDE.
  • Entrenamiento del equipo: Intellicode puede ser entrenado en la base de código de tu equipo, proporcionando sugerencias más relevantes.
  • Soporte para múltiples lenguajes: Desde C# hasta Python, Intellicode ofrece soporte para varios lenguajes de programación.

Dónde se queda corto: La estrecha integración de Intellicode con las herramientas de Microsoft podría hacerlo menos atractivo para los desarrolladores que utilizan otros IDE.

7. CodeT5 — El asistente de IA basado en transformadores

CodeT5 es un modelo basado en transformadores entrenado específicamente para tareas relacionadas con el código. Ofrece una gama de funciones, incluyendo la finalización de código, la summarización e incluso la detección de errores.

¿Por qué considerar CodeT5?

  • Arquitectura de transformadores: Construido sobre modelos de transformadores de última generación, CodeT5 proporciona sugerencias de código de alta calidad.
  • Código abierto: Como herramienta de código abierto, CodeT5 es flexible y personalizable.
  • Multifuncional: Además de la finalización de código, CodeT5 puede ayudar con la summarización de código y la detección de errores.

Dónde se queda corto: La configuración y configuración de CodeT5 puede ser un poco compleja, lo que podría disuadir a los desarrolladores menos experimentados.

8. Visual Studio IntelliSense — La herramienta clásica de autocompletado de código

IntelliSense es la herramienta de autocompletado de código integrada de Microsoft, integrada en Visual Studio y Visual Studio Code. Aunque no es tan avanzada como algunas herramientas impulsadas por IA, IntelliSense sigue siendo una opción fiable para muchos desarrolladores.

¿Por qué considerar IntelliSense?

  • Integración profunda: IntelliSense está integrado en Visual Studio y VSCode, proporcionando una experiencia de codificación perfecta.
  • Soporte de idiomas: Soporta una amplia gama de lenguajes, lo que lo convierte en una herramienta versátil.
  • Familiaridad: Para los desarrolladores que ya utilizan las herramientas de Microsoft, IntelliSense no requiere ninguna configuración adicional.

Dónde se queda corto: IntelliSense no ofrece el mismo nivel de inteligencia que las herramientas más nuevas impulsadas por IA, lo que podría hacerlo menos atractivo para aquellos que buscan funciones más avanzadas.

9. Eclipse Che — El IDE de nube de código abierto

Eclipse Che es más que un simple editor de código; es un entorno de desarrollo basado en la nube que soporta la codificación colaborativa. Ofrece una gama de plugins y extensiones, lo que lo hace altamente personalizable.

¿Por qué considerar Eclipse Che?

  • Basado en la nube: Eclipse Che se ejecuta en la nube, lo que lo hace accesible desde cualquier lugar y permite una fácil colaboración.
  • Código abierto: Al ser de código abierto, Eclipse Che puede adaptarse para satisfacer tus necesidades específicas.
  • Extensibilidad: Con una amplia gama de plugins y extensiones, Eclipse Che puede transformarse en un potente entorno de desarrollo.

Dónde se queda corto: La naturaleza basada en la nube de Eclipse Che podría ser un inconveniente para los desarrolladores que prefieren los entornos de desarrollo locales.

Mejora tu flujo de trabajo con Apidog

Ahora que hemos explorado las 9 mejores alternativas a Cursor AI, hablemos de una herramienta que puede llevar tu experiencia de desarrollo al siguiente nivel: Apidog. Si estás involucrado en el desarrollo o las pruebas de API, Apidog es el compañero perfecto para estos editores de código impulsados por IA.

¿Por qué Apidog?

  • Desarrollo de API optimizado: Apidog simplifica todo el proceso de desarrollo de API. Ya sea que estés diseñando, probando o documentando APIs, Apidog proporciona una plataforma unificada para gestionarlo todo.
  • Documentación autogenerada: Olvídate de la molestia de la documentación manual. Con Apidog, la documentación de tu API se genera automáticamente, manteniendo todo actualizado y reduciendo los errores.
  • Entorno de pruebas robusto: Apidog ofrece un potente entorno de pruebas que te permite validar tus APIs con facilidad. Ya sea que te estés integrando con otras herramientas como GitHub Copilot o Codeium, Apidog asegura que tus APIs sean fiables y estén bien probadas.
  • Colaboración facilitada: Con funciones diseñadas para el trabajo en equipo, Apidog facilita la colaboración en proyectos de API. Comparte tu progreso, recopila comentarios y asegúrate de que todos estén en la misma página.

Ya sea que estés utilizando una herramienta versátil como TabNine o una opción de código abierto como Eclipse Che, Apidog se integra perfectamente en tu flujo de trabajo, mejorando la productividad y asegurando que tus APIs sean de primera categoría.

Elegir la herramienta adecuada para ti

Cada una de estas alternativas a Cursor AI tiene sus propias fortalezas y debilidades. La mejor elección depende de tus necesidades específicas, tu estilo de codificación y los lenguajes de programación con los que trabajes. Si estás buscando una herramienta que se integre perfectamente con tu flujo de trabajo existente, considera herramientas como GitHub Copilot o Intellicode de Microsoft. Si el código abierto es una prioridad, Codeium y CodeT5 son excelentes opciones.

30 Mejores Alternativas a Postman en 2025 | Herramientas Gratuitas y de Código Abierto para Pruebas de APIReseñas de software

30 Mejores Alternativas a Postman en 2025 | Herramientas Gratuitas y de Código Abierto para Pruebas de API

En este artículo, exploraremos alternativas a Postman, sus características, ventajas y desventajas. Comprenderás mejor las opciones principales y elegirás la mejor herramienta para tus necesidades de desarrollo de API.

Daniel Costa

April 11, 2025

Las mejores herramientas de pruebas de automatización sin código de 2025Reseñas de software

Las mejores herramientas de pruebas de automatización sin código de 2025

Explora el poder de las herramientas de automatización de pruebas sin código y cómo revolucionan el control de calidad. Descubre cómo agilizan y facilitan las pruebas.

Daniel Costa

April 8, 2025

Herramientas gratuitas de IA de Google para transformar tus proyectosReseñas de software

Herramientas gratuitas de IA de Google para transformar tus proyectos

Explora 12 herramientas IA Google gratis. Gemini, traducción, voz, visión e infraestructura. ¡Transforma tus proyectos sin costo!

Daniel Costa

April 2, 2025